* Strangely, I do not really know of any APIs which are deliberately developed with autocomplete in your mind. I do know numerous APIs, which include Processing, which can be suitable for brevity, that is irrelevant within an surroundings with great autocomplete.

There's two style choices here. One choice will be to reduce the condition. One example is, color can be handed as a parameter to your "triangle" functionality.

A person can certainly start off from an current Processing system and modify it, even so the language would not inspire combining two plans.

The split with the ideal cost (lowest Expense mainly because we limit cost) is selected. All enter variables and all achievable split factors are evaluated and chosen inside of a greedy way depending on the expense purpose.

You could display a Radiobutton without the dot indicator. In that case it shows its condition by staying sunken or elevated.

It truly is tempting to consider this as "inline help", but it's not help -- It truly is just labeling. The challenge with the following UI is just not that it lacks a "help feature". The condition is that nothing is labeled.

In lieu of drawing an evenly-spaced row of homes, the programmer now desires specific Manage more than each of the homes. Ranging from the variable abstraction, she selects the code and converts it right into a purpose.

You’ll get some great tools for your personal programming toolkit On this study course! You might: Start coding while in the programming language Python;

I used to be recently seeing an artist Good friend start out a painting, And that i asked him what a specific shape on the canvas was likely to be. He said that he wasn't confident nevertheless; he was just "pushing paint all over on the canvas", reacting to and acquiring encouraged by the types that emerged.

No, not really. But none of the examples On this area are "programming". Typing inside the code to draw a static condition --

Developing a process that supports recomposition requires prolonged and cautious thought, and layout choices which make programming much more convenient for individuals can be detrimental to social creation.

So how exactly does she make balls draggable With all the mouse? In a real Finding out setting which include Etoys, this development is natural and encouraged. In Processing, each of these actions can be a nightmare of Unnecessary complexity.

Almost click this site every line of code here calculates a little something. The setting really should supply the best visualization of whichever that one thing is. For instance, the "rotate" line can clearly show the rotations.

Making a decision tree entails contacting the above mentioned formulated get_split() purpose over and over yet again about the teams developed for every node.

